    "Certainly worth looking at if you enjoyed the original film"

    While the original movie was quite suspenseful this movie is over three hours long which not only makes the suspense last longer but also allows you to focus more on the characters and their own personal issues. This movie really had me really excited especially during the final twenty minutes, which grabbed me by the throat and refused to let go!

    This movie has the same basic storyline as the original film, a capsized cruise ship the Poseidon and a group of survivors makes an audacious attempt to reach the hull of ship while trying to bypass many life threatening hazards and death traps. But while the Poseidon was capsized by as tsunami in the original film, in this TV remake the Poseidon is capsized by a terrorist bombing. Also while the original film only told the story from the survivors point of view, this film also explains the situation outside the Poseidon. For example the ocean radio monitoring service trying to figure out what happened to the Poseidon when all radio contact is lost, and once the situation is learned we see the navy and marines racing against time to reach the Poseidon and discussing how they are going to rescue any survivors.

    However there will also be another remake of 'The Poseidon Adventure' released early next year. This time it will be a major film called 'Poseidon'. Why are they making to remakes so close together? I'm not sure but it has been done before. For example in 1996 a TV movie was released of 'Titanic' just a year before James Camerons multiple Oscar winning film was released.

    Also I wonder why this TV movie was released in Australia before it is even released in America? But it's good that we Aussies get to be the first to see this great TV remake of a classic suspense thriller. All together this is certainly one highly suspenseful movie and I certainly recommend it to anyone who is a fan of the original film.

    Blame the screenwriter and director

    On the surface, a movie like the Poseidon Adventure is almost impossible to screw up. Put a bunch of well known faces on the screen in a life or death situation and you should have something compelling and interesting. Sadly, this is not the case in this below average remake. That's because the script never developed the characters enough to allow us to empathize with or feel for them. The death of Mrs. Rosen is a prime example: in the original it made you cry, not only for her, but for her husband and Gene Hackman's Reverand Scott. Here, she was a widow who's only contribution was to udder silly reminisces about her dead husband Manny. Her death was like "Goodbye Mrs. Rosen, we hardly knew yee", as Rutger Haurer's character appears only mildy disturbed, as if her death is an unneeded distraction. Furthermore, the direction was unsuccessful in creating the suspense and sense of impending doom that dominated the original. There is no conflict or tension between the characters like in the first either, mainly because there is no definitive leader of the group akin to Reverand Scott. What it comes down to is you can't have a disaster movie where you can't relate to the characters and fully appreciate the danger they're in. That's what it's about. Any discussion of special effects and the plausibility of the plot is just ancillary.

    • Wissenswertes
      Some characters and rooms were renamed to pay homage. The ship's Captain was named Captain Gallico for Writer Paul Gallico, on whose novel this movie was based; the ship's doctor was named Dr. Ballard for Robert Ballard, leader of the 1985 expedition that discovered the remains of R.M.S. Titanic; the ship's lounge was named Jak's Lounge for Jak Castro, President of The Poseidon Adventure Fan Club.
    • Patzer
      A woman is able to send a distress email even though the terrorists have cut all ship-to-shore communications, the ship is on emergency power, and the antennas and satellite dishes are underwater and pointed at the ocean floor.
